Which of the following is a monolithic temple?*
Question
Which of the following is a monolithic temple?*
Solution
You haven't provided any options for the question. However, a monolithic temple is a structure that is carved, cut or excavated from a single piece of rock. An example of a monolithic temple is the Kailasa Temple in Ellora, India.
